Background: The primary reason for adult tooth extractions is periodontal disease. The present study was conducted to assess relationship between body mass index and periodontal status. Materials & Methods: 120 subjects of both genders were selected. BMI was calculated by the Quetelet index as the ratio of the subject's body weight (in kg) to the square of the height (in meters. Periodontal status was recorded using the Community Periodontal Index (CPI).
